Perodua Kancil K4 660 Service

General Information

Vehicle Models

  • L200RS-GKRSM
  • L200RS-KMDSM
  • Engine: EF-CL
  • Catalyzer: Without
  • Fuel system: Carburetor
  • Fuel evaporative canister: Without
  • Destination: Malaysia

Explanation of Vehicle Model Code

L2 Kancil
0 Drive 2WD
0 Engine 660cc
R Right hand drive
S Sedan
G 5-door with hatch back
K/M K: 4-speed manual transmission
M: 5-speed manual transmission
D/R D: Deluxe
R: Standard
S Carburetor equipped engine
M Malaysia

Specifications

Pre-delivery Inspection Specifications

Item Specifications
Tire inflation pressure front/rear; 145/70R12; kpa (kg/cm²) 220 (2.2)
Wheel nut tightening torque; N⋅m (kgf⋅m, ft-lb) 88–11.7 (9–12, 65–87)
Accelerator cable free play; mm (inch) 0.5–1.0 (0.020–0.039)
Idle speed; rpm EF-CL 900 (+100/-50)
Engine oil Capacity 2.6 (whole)
Grade API SE or higher
Manual transmission oil Grade Castrol MTEC, API GL 4
Viscosity SAE 80 W
Capacity 1.42 (4-speed)
1.60 (5-speed)
Brake fluid Grade DOT 3 or SEA J1703
Brake pedal free play; mm (inch) 7–12 (0.27–0.47) while engine is stopped
Clutch pedal free play; mm (inch) 10–30 (0.40–1.18)
Parking brake lever Should “set” within 2–6 notdches when apply 20 kgf by hand
Exhaust emission concentration 1.5 (+1.0/-0.5)
(At tail pipe) 800

Vehicle Specifications

Item Specifications
EF-CL
Engine Type Carburetor, 4-cycle
Displacement; cc 659
Bore × Stroke; mm (inch) 68.0 × 60.5 (2.68 × 2.38)
Compression ratio 9.5
Firing order 1-2-3
Ignition timing 7 ± 2° BTDC/900 rpm
Valve mechanism Overhead camshaft
Valve clearance; Hot; mm (inch) Intake 0.25 ± 0.05 (0.0098 ± 0.0020)
Exhaust 0.30 ± 0.05 (0.0118 ± 0.0020)
Spark plug type Denso W16EX-U, W16EXR-U
NGK BP5ES, BPR5ES
Spark plug gap; mm (inch) Denso 0.7–0.8 (0.0275–0.0315)
NGK 0.7–0.8 (0.0275–0.0315)
Coolant capacity (w/o reserve tank) 2.6
Collant reserve tank (Low, full) 0.15, 0.35
Max. output power; kW/rpm 22.8/6400
Max. output torque; N⋅m/rpm 49/3200
Recommendation fuel Octane No. 90 (RON) or higher
Fuel tank capacity 32
Clutch Type Dry single plate, diaphragm
Operation Mechanical
Transmission Type 4 or 5-speed M/T
Gear ratio 1st 3.500
2nd 2.111
3rd 1.392
4th 0.971
5th 0.794
Reverse 3.538
Final drive ratio 4.722
Suspension Front suspension Independent, Macpherson strut with stabilizer
Rear suspension Independent, semi-trailing
Steering Type Rack & Pinion (Constant gear)
Gear ratio 20.2 (Overall)
Brakes System Power-assisted, front/rear split hydraulic circuits
Type Front disc, Rear drum
Wheel & Tyre Tire size 145/70R12
Wheel size 4.00 B × 12
Wheel offset +50
Headlights; mm 60/55
Clearance lights (w) 5
Front turn signal lights (w) 21
Front side turn signal lights (w) 5
Rear turn signal lights (w) 21
Tail lights (w) 5
Stop lights (w) 21
Back-up lights (w) 21
License plate lights (w) 5
Interior lights (w) 5
High-mounted stop lights (w) 21

Charging System Circuit

CH00003-99999

Troubleshooting

Problem Possible cause Remedies
Charge warning lamp will not glow even if ignition switch is turned ON. Fuse blown Check gauge fuse.
Lamp bulb burnt Replace bulb.
Poor connection of wiring Repair poor connection of wiring
Open wire Repair or replace.
IC regulator faulty Replace regulator assembly.
Charge warning lamp will not go out even if engine has started. Drive belt loose or worn Adjust or replace.
Battery cables loose, corroded or worn Repair or replace cables.
Fuse blown Check gauge fuse.
Fusible link blown Replace Fusible link.
IC regulator or alternator faulty Check charging system.
Wiring taulty Repair or replace.

In-vehicle Inspection

  1. Prior to the in-vehicle inspection, be sure to perform the following checks.
    1. Specific gravity of battery electrolyte
    2. Installation of battery terminals
    3. Tension of V-belt
    4. Fuse
    5. Wiring harness
    6. Abnormal noise emitted from alternator while engine is rotating
  2. Output test under unloaded state
    1. Ensure that all switches are turned OFF so that no unnecessary electric load may be applied.
      • Headlamps
      • Heater blower
      • Radio
      • Rear defogger
      • Room lamp, etc.
    2. Raise the engine revolution speed gradually to 2500 грm.
      Measure the current and voltage at 2500 rpm.
      Specifications:
      • 10 A or more
      • 14.2 - 14.8 V
    3. NOTE:
      • Immediately after the engine starting, the current may jump to 10 A or more momentarily. This is not an abnormal phenomenon.
      • If the voltage reading i s less than the standard voltage, ground the terminal F as indicated in the right figure. Proceed to start the engine.
      • If the voltage reading becomes greater than the standard voltage under this setting, replace the IC regulator.
      • If the voltage reading is still less than the standard voltage under this setting, check the alternator.
  3. Output test under loaded state
    1. To apply electric load, perform the following operation.
      1. Set the headlamps to the upper-beam position.
      2. Set the heater blower to the “High” position.
    2. Measure the output current of the alternator at the engine speed of 2500 rpm.
      • Specified Value: 20 A or more
    3. NOTE:
      • When the battery is fully charged, the measured current may be below the specified value. This is not an abnormal phenomenon.
      • At this time, increase the electric load, for example, by turning ON the rear defogger.
      • Then, check to see if the output current rises or not.
